Split glib.h into many header files mostly according to the resp.
2000-10-12 Sebastian Wilhelmi <wilhelmi@ira.uka.de>
* glib.h, galloca.h, garray.h, gasyncqueue.h, gbacktrace.h,
gcache.h, gcompletion.h, gconvert.h, gdataset.h, gdate.h, ghash.h,
ghook.h, giochannel.h, glist.h , gmacros.h, gmain.h, gmem.h,
gmessages.h, gnode.h, gprimes.h, gquark.h, gqueue.h, grand.h,
grel.h, gscanner.h, gslist.h, gstrfuncs.h, gstring.h, gthread.h,
gthreadpool.h, gtimer.h, gtree.h, gtypes.h, gutils.h: Split glib.h
into many header files mostly according to the resp. *.c-files.
* gmacros.h: Added G_BEGIN_DECLS and G_END_DECLS to mean: 'in case
of C++: extern "C" { ... }' analogous to glibc __BEGIN_DECLS and
__END_DECLS.
* configure.in, gerror.h, gfileutils.h, gshell.h, gspawn.h,
gunicode.h, : Changed guard-macro names to something more
consistent.
* configure.in, *.h: Use G_BEGIN_DECLS and G_END_DECLS.

diff --git a/gutils.h b/gutils.h new file mode 100644 index 000000000..62cc2154e --- /dev/null +++ b/gutils.h @@ -0,0 +1,333 @@ +/* GLIB - Library of useful routines for C programming + * Copyright (C) 1995-1997 Peter Mattis, Spencer Kimball and Josh MacDonald + * + * This library is free software; you can redistribute it and/or + * modify it under the terms of the GNU Lesser General Public + * License as published by the Free Software Foundation; either + * version 2 of the License, or (at your option) any later version. + * + * This library is distributed in the hope that it will be useful, + * but WITHOUT ANY WARRANTY; without even the implied warranty of + *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the GNU + * Lesser General Public License for more details. + * + * You should have received a copy of the GNU Lesser General Public + * License along with this library; if not, write to the + * Free Software Foundation, Inc., 59 Temple Place - Suite 330, + * Boston, MA 02111-1307, USA. + */ + +/* + * Modified by the GLib Team and others 1997-2000. See the AUTHORS + * file for a list of people on the GLib Team. See the ChangeLog + * files for a list of changes. These files are distributed with + * GLib at ftp://ftp.gtk.org/pub/gtk/. + */ + +#ifndef __G_UTILS_H__ +#define __G_UTILS_H__ + +#include <gtypes.h> +#include <stdarg.h> + +G_BEGIN_DECLS + +#ifdef G_OS_WIN32 + +/* On native Win32, directory separator is the backslash, and search path + * separator is the semicolon. + */ +#define G_DIR_SEPARATOR '\\' +#define G_DIR_SEPARATOR_S "\\" +#define G_SEARCHPATH_SEPARATOR ';' +#define G_SEARCHPATH_SEPARATOR_S ";" + +#else /* !G_OS_WIN32 */ + +/* Unix */ + +#define G_DIR_SEPARATOR '/' +#define G_DIR_SEPARATOR_S "/" +#define G_SEARCHPATH_SEPARATOR ':' +#define G_SEARCHPATH_SEPARATOR_S ":" + +#endif /* !G_OS_WIN32 */ + +/* Define G_VA_COPY() to do the right thing for copying va_list variables. + * glibconfig.h may have already defined G_VA_COPY as va_copy or __va_copy. + */ +#if !defined (G_VA_COPY) +# if defined (__GNUC__) && defined (__PPC__) && (defined (_CALL_SYSV) || defined (_WIN32)) +# define G_VA_COPY(ap1, ap2) (*(ap1) = *(ap2)) +# elif defined (G_VA_COPY_AS_ARRAY) +# define G_VA_COPY(ap1, ap2) g_memmove ((ap1), (ap2), sizeof (va_list)) +# else /* va_list is a pointer */ +# define G_VA_COPY(ap1, ap2) ((ap1) = (ap2)) +# endif /* va_list is a pointer */ +#endif /* !G_VA_COPY */ + +/* inlining hassle. for compilers that don't allow the `inline' keyword, + * mostly because of strict ANSI C compliance or dumbness, we try to fall + * back to either `__inline__' or `__inline'. + * we define G_CAN_INLINE, if the compiler seems to be actually + * *capable* to do function inlining, in which case inline function bodys + * do make sense. we also define G_INLINE_FUNC to properly export the + * function prototypes if no inlining can be performed. + * inline function bodies have to be special cased with G_CAN_INLINE and a + * .c file specific macro to allow one compiled instance with extern linkage + * of the functions by defining G_IMPLEMENT_INLINES and the .c file macro. + */ +#ifdef G_IMPLEMENT_INLINES +# define G_INLINE_FUNC extern +# undef G_CAN_INLINE +#endif +#ifndef G_INLINE_FUNC +# define G_CAN_INLINE 1 +#endif +#if defined (G_HAVE_INLINE) && defined (__GNUC__) && defined (__STRICT_ANSI__) +# undef inline +# define inline __inline__ +#elif !defined (G_HAVE_INLINE) +# undef inline +# if defined (G_HAVE___INLINE__) +# define inline __inline__ +# elif defined (G_HAVE___INLINE) +# define inline __inline +# else /* !inline && !__inline__ && !__inline */ +# define inline /* don't inline, then */ +# ifndef G_INLINE_FUNC +# undef G_CAN_INLINE +# endif +# endif +#endif +#ifndef G_INLINE_FUNC +# if defined (__GNUC__) && (__OPTIMIZE__) +# define G_INLINE_FUNC extern inline +# elif defined (G_CAN_INLINE) && !defined (__GNUC__) +# define G_INLINE_FUNC static inline +# else /* can't inline */ +# define G_INLINE_FUNC extern +# undef G_CAN_INLINE +# endif +#endif /* !G_INLINE_FUNC */ + +/* Retrive static string info + */ +gchar* g_get_user_name (void); +gchar* g_get_real_name (void); +gchar* g_get_home_dir (void); +gchar* g_get_tmp_dir (void); +gchar* g_get_prgname (void); +void g_set_prgname (const gchar *prgname); + + +typedef struct _GDebugKey GDebugKey; +struct _GDebugKey +{ + gchar *key; + guint value; +}; + +/* Miscellaneous utility functions + */ +guint g_parse_debug_string (const gchar *string, + GDebugKey *keys, + guint nkeys); +gint g_snprintf (gchar *string, + gulong n, + gchar const *format, + ...) G_GNUC_PRINTF (3, 4); +gint g_vsnprintf (gchar *string, + gulong n, + gchar const *format, + va_list args); +/* Check if a file name is an absolute path */ +gboolean g_path_is_absolute (const gchar *file_name); +/* In case of absolute paths, skip the root part */ +gchar* g_path_skip_root (gchar *file_name); + +/* These two functions are deprecated and will be removed in the next + * major release of GLib. Use g_path_get_dirname/g_path_get_basename + * instead. Whatch out! The string returned by g_path_get_basename + * must be g_freed, while the string returned by g_basename must not.*/ +gchar* g_basename (const gchar *file_name); +gchar* g_dirname (const gchar *file_name); + +/* The returned strings are newly allocated with g_malloc() */ +gchar* g_get_current_dir (void); +gchar* g_path_get_basename (const gchar *file_name); +gchar* g_path_get_dirname (const gchar *file_name); + +/* Get the codeset for the current locale */ +/* gchar * g_get_codeset (void); */ + +/* return the environment string for the variable. The returned memory + * must not be freed. */ +gchar* g_getenv (const gchar *variable); + + +/* we try to provide a usefull equivalent for ATEXIT if it is + * not defined, but use is actually abandoned. people should + * use g_atexit() instead. + */ +typedef void (*GVoidFunc) (void); +#ifndef ATEXIT +# define ATEXIT(proc) g_ATEXIT(proc) +#else +# define G_NATIVE_ATEXIT +#endif /* ATEXIT */ +/* we use a GLib function as a replacement for ATEXIT, so + * the programmer is not required to check the return value + * (if there is any in the implementation) and doesn't encounter + * missing include files. + */ +void g_atexit (GVoidFunc func); + + +/* Bit tests + */ +G_INLINE_FUNC gint g_bit_nth_lsf (guint32 mask, + gint nth_bit); +G_INLINE_FUNC gint g_bit_nth_msf (guint32 mask, + gint nth_bit); +G_INLINE_FUNC guint g_bit_storage (guint number); + +/* Trash Stacks + * elements need to be >= sizeof (gpointer) + */ +typedef struct _GTrashStack GTrashStack; +struct _GTrashStack +{ + GTrashStack *next; +}; + +G_INLINE_FUNC void g_trash_stack_push (GTrashStack **stack_p, + gpointer data_p); +G_INLINE_FUNC gpointer g_trash_stack_pop (GTrashStack **stack_p); +G_INLINE_FUNC gpointer g_trash_stack_peek (GTrashStack **stack_p); +G_INLINE_FUNC guint g_trash_stack_height (GTrashStack **stack_p); + +/* inline function implementations + */ +#if defined (G_CAN_INLINE) || defined (__G_UTILS_C__) +G_INLINE_FUNC gint +g_bit_nth_lsf (guint32 mask, + gint nth_bit) +{ + do + { + nth_bit++; + if (mask & (1 << (guint) nth_bit)) + return nth_bit; + } + while (nth_bit < 32); + return -1; +} +G_INLINE_FUNC gint +g_bit_nth_msf (guint32 mask, + gint nth_bit) +{ + if (nth_bit < 0) + nth_bit = 32; + do + { + nth_bit--; + if (mask & (1 << (guint) nth_bit)) + return nth_bit; + } + while (nth_bit > 0); + return -1; +} +G_INLINE_FUNC guint +g_bit_storage (guint number) +{ + register guint n_bits = 0; + + do + { + n_bits++; + number >>= 1; + } + while (number); + return n_bits; +} +G_INLINE_FUNC void +g_trash_stack_push (GTrashStack **stack_p, + gpointer data_p) +{ + GTrashStack *data = (GTrashStack *) data_p; + + data->next = *stack_p; + *stack_p = data; +} +G_INLINE_FUNC gpointer +g_trash_stack_pop (GTrashStack **stack_p) +{ + GTrashStack *data; + + data = *stack_p; + if (data) + { + *stack_p = data->next; + /* NULLify private pointer here, most platforms store NULL as + * subsequent 0 bytes + */ + data->next = NULL; + } + + return data; +} +G_INLINE_FUNC gpointer +g_trash_stack_peek (GTrashStack **stack_p) +{ + GTrashStack *data; + + data = *stack_p; + + return data; +} +G_INLINE_FUNC guint +g_trash_stack_height (GTrashStack **stack_p) +{ + GTrashStack *data; + guint i = 0; + + for (data = *stack_p; data; data = data->next) + i++; + + return i; +} +#endif /* G_CAN_INLINE || __G_UTILS_C__ */ + +/* Glib version. + * we prefix variable declarations so they can + * properly get exported in windows dlls. + */ +#ifdef G_OS_WIN32 +# ifdef GLIB_COMPILATION +# define GLIB_VAR __declspec(dllexport) +# else /* !GLIB_COMPILATION */ +# define GLIB_VAR extern __declspec(dllimport) +# endif /* !GLIB_COMPILATION */ +#else /* !G_OS_WIN32 */ +# define GLIB_VAR extern +#endif /* !G_OS_WIN32 */ + +GLIB_VAR const guint glib_major_version; +GLIB_VAR const guint glib_minor_version; +GLIB_VAR const guint glib_micro_version; +GLIB_VAR const guint glib_interface_age; +GLIB_VAR const guint glib_binary_age; + +#define GLIB_CHECK_VERSION(major,minor,micro) \ + (GLIB_MAJOR_VERSION > (major) || \ + (GLIB_MAJOR_VERSION == (major) && GLIB_MINOR_VERSION > (minor)) || \ + (GLIB_MAJOR_VERSION == (major) && GLIB_MINOR_VERSION == (minor) && \ + GLIB_MICRO_VERSION >= (micro))) + +G_END_DECLS + +#endif /* __G_UTILS_H__ */ + + + |
